Derivative of a Changing Rectangle
Description
The Product Rule helps find the derivative of a product of two changing functions. In calculus, it states that the derivative of one function times another equals the first function times the rate of change of the second, plus the second function times the rate of change of the first. The Product Rule differentiates functions formed by the product of two functions.
It says the derivative of two functions u and v is the sum of u times the derivative of v and v times the derivative of u.
To understand why, imagine resizing a rectangular window on a screen. Its area equals width times height.
